Introduction:
At Nextwebi, we understand the significance of SAAS (Software as a Service) applications in today's digital landscape. As a leading web application development company, we specialize in providing comprehensive SAAS application development services. With our expertise in full stack development, we deliver high-quality and scalable solutions that cater to the unique needs of businesses across various industries. In this blog, we will dive into the world of SAAS application development, exploring its benefits, our approach, and why Nextwebi is the ideal partner for your SAAS application development needs.
1. Understanding SAAS Application Development:
SAAS applications have gained immense popularity due to their ease of use, scalability, and cost-effectiveness. These applications are hosted on the cloud and can be accessed by users through a web browser. At Nextwebi, we specialize in developing SAAS applications that offer seamless user experiences, advanced functionality, and robust security features. Our team of experienced developers understands the complexities involved in creating SAAS applications and leverages cutting-edge technologies to deliver exceptional results.
2. The Benefits of SAAS Application Development:
SAAS applications offer numerous benefits for businesses, including:
a. Cost-effectiveness: SAAS applications eliminate the need for expensive infrastructure and hardware, as they are hosted on the cloud. This significantly reduces upfront costs and allows businesses to pay for only the resources they need.
b. Scalability: SAAS applications can easily scale as per the business requirements. They can accommodate a growing number of users and handle increased data without compromising performance.
c. Accessibility: SAAS applications can be accessed from anywhere, anytime, as long as there is an internet connection. This enhances flexibility and allows users to work remotely without any restrictions.
d. Maintenance and Updates: With SAAS applications, the responsibility of maintenance and updates lies with the service provider. This ensures that businesses always have access to the latest features and enhancements without the hassle of managing them in-house.
3. Key Features of SAAS Applications:
SAAS applications offer a wide range of features that enhance business operations and user experiences. Some key features include:
a. Multi-tenancy: SAAS applications are designed to serve multiple customers (tenants) from a single application instance. This enables cost-sharing and efficient resource utilization.
b. User Management: SAAS applications provide robust user management capabilities, allowing administrators to define roles, permissions, and access levels for different users.
c. Data Security: SAAS applications prioritize data security and implement measures such as encryption, secure authentication, and regular backups to ensure data integrity and protection.
d. Payment Integration: SAAS applications often integrate with payment gateways to facilitate secure and seamless online transactions for subscription-based services.
e. Analytics and Reporting: SAAS applications include analytics and reporting features that allow businesses to gather insights, monitor performance, and generate detailed reports.
4. SAAS Application Development Challenges:
While SAAS applications offer numerous benefits, there are certain challenges that need to be addressed during development:
a. Scalability: Developing a scalable SAAS application requires careful planning and architecture design to accommodate a growing user base and increased data volume.
b. Security: As SAAS applications handle sensitive data, security is of paramount importance. Implementing robust security measures, such as data encryption and access controls, is crucial.
c. Performance Optimization: SAAS applications must be optimized for speed and performance to ensure a seamless user experience, even with a large number of concurrent users.
d. Integration: SAAS applications often need to integrate with external systems or APIs, such as payment gateways, third-party applications, or existing infrastructure. Seamless integration is essential for smooth operations.
5. SAAS Application Maintenance and Support:
After the development phase, maintaining and supporting the SAAS application is critical for its long-term success. Nextwebi offers ongoing maintenance and support services, including bug fixing, feature enhancements, security updates, and technical assistance. This ensures that your SAAS application remains up-to-date, secure, and fully functional.
6. SAAS Application Deployment Options:
Nextwebi provides flexibility when it comes to deploying your SAAS application. We can assist in deploying the application on a reliable cloud hosting platform, such as AWS or Azure, or on dedicated servers based on your specific requirements. We ensure that the deployment process is seamless and optimized for performance and scalability.
7. Nextwebi's Approach to SAAS Application Development:
Nextwebi follows a comprehensive approach to SAAS application development to ensure client satisfaction and project success. Our approach includes:
a. Requirement Analysis: We start by understanding the client's business objectives, target audience, and specific requirements. This helps us define the scope of the project and set clear goals.
b. Prototyping and Design: Our skilled designers create intuitive and user-friendly interfaces that enhance the overall user experience. We focus on creating a visually appealing design that aligns with the client's branding guidelines.
c. Full Stack Development: Nextwebi excels in full stack development services, which allows us to handle both frontend and backend development efficiently. Our team utilizes modern technologies and frameworks to build robust and scalable SAAS applications.
d. Testing & Quality Assurance: We conduct rigorous testing to ensure that the SAAS application functions flawlessly and provides a seamless user experience. Our quality assurance team performs various tests, including functional testing, performance testing, and security testing, to identify and fix any issues.
e. Deployment and Support: Nextwebi assists in the deployment of the SAAS application on a secure and reliable hosting platform. We also provide ongoing support and maintenance services to address any future requirements or issues that may arise.
8. Why Choose Nextwebi for SAAS Application Development:
Nextwebi stands out as the preferred partner for SAAS application development due to the following reasons:
a. Experience: With several years of experience in web application development, Nextwebi has honed its skills in creating high-quality SAAS applications. Our expertise ensures that we deliver solutions that exceed client expectations.
b. Skilled Team: We have a team of skilled developers, designers, and project managers who work collaboratively to deliver exceptional SAAS applications. Our team stays updated with the latest trends and technologies to provide cutting-edge solutions.
c. Customized Solutions: We understand that every business is unique, and we tailor our SAAS application development services to meet specific requirements. Our solutions are scalable, secure, and designed to provide a competitive edge.
d. Client Satisfaction: Nextwebi prioritizes client satisfaction above all else. We believe in open communication, transparency, and timely project delivery. Our team ensures that clients are involved at every stage of the development process, resulting in successful outcomes.
Conclusion:
SAAS application development is a complex process that requires expertise in full stack development, user experience design, security, scalability, and integration. Nextwebi, as a leading web application development company, excels in all these aspects. Our focus on client satisfaction, custom solutions, and attention to detail make us the ideal partner for businesses seeking top-quality SAAS application development services. Trust Nextwebi to deliver a cutting-edge SAAS application that meets your unique business requirements and propels your success in the digital era.